WHY WATER BASED COOLING? Due to the problems with Cooling Towers, many clients have gone to air-cooled equipment. Too bad since an air-cooled system has an innate efficiency of around 1.2 KW/ton whereas a water-cooled system has an innate efficiency of around.85 KW/ton.

300-ton system running 50% of the year says: Air-cooled = $164,400 / year energy cost Water-cooled = $116,500 / year energy cost CALL IT: $50,000 / year savings

Then, Why Air cooled? This low maintenance model has been engrained in many of the districts that they default to air-cooled. Understandable when it adds a maintenance headache.but this will go away (mostly) with the Geothermal option.
